之前遇到一个有关 androidboot.slot suffix 的问题,发现该kernel cmdline作为后缀会被用来拼接位于fastab中的分区名 如vendor oem分区等 。如果该cmdline的值传递不正确会使fstab中的分区挂载点出错,导致无法正确挂载分区。通过阅读源码定位到更新fstab中分区后缀的代码位于 system core fs mgr fs mgr boot co ...
2017-10-19 15:35 0 1110 推荐指数:
/details/41142801 利用工作之便,今天研究了kernel下cmdline参数解析过程,记录 ...
利用工作之便,今天研究了kernel下cmdline參数解析过程。记录在此。与大家共享。转载请注明出处。谢谢。Kernel 版本:3.4.55Kernel启动时会解析cmdline,然后依据这些參数如console root来进行配置执行。Cmdline是由bootloader传给 ...
在uboot中设置bootargs环境变量,在kernel启动后cat /proc/cmdline可以看到bootargs的值。 U-boot的环境变量值得注意的有两个: bootcmd 和bootargs。 eg:setenv bootcmd ‘setenv bootargs ...
Kernel启动时会解析cmdline,然后根据这些参数如console root来进行配置运行。 Cmdline是由bootloader传给kernel,如uboot,将需要传给kernel的参数做成一个tags链表放在ram中,将首地址传给kernel,kernel解析tags来获取 ...
进入Android studio的settings添加tool工具 ...
重要结构体 struct socket 结构体 struct socket 的创建 sock_create() 函数 ...
备注:使用make –debug=b 获得各个编译目标的依赖关系和顺序。 默认为 编译第一个目标 _all make 后面没有指定目标,默认为 编译第一个目标 _all 以 -include 包 ...